What should I do if I have a sewer backup in my Elizabeth City home?
A sewer backup is a serious issue often linked to main line blockages or tree root intrusion. First, stop using all water fixtures to prevent further backup. Then, call us for immediate emergency service. Our licensed plumbers use specialized drain inspection cameras to pinpoint the exact cause and location of the blockage in your pipes. We then provide a clear repair plan, which may involve high-pressure hydro-jetting to clear the line or targeted repairs to damaged sections, effectively resolving the local issue and preventing future backups.
Do you offer plumbing inspections for older homes in the area?
Yes, we strongly recommend regular plumbing inspections for older homes, which are common in Elizabeth City's historic neighborhoods. Our comprehensive inspection assesses the condition of your water pipes, shutoff valves, drains, and fixtures. We check for signs of corrosion, leaks, or outdated materials that could lead to problems. This proactive service helps identify issues like worn-out valves before they fail, allowing for planned repairs that can prevent water damage and more costly emergency calls down the line.
Can you repair a broken shutoff valve without causing major disruption?
Absolutely. Replacing a broken or seized shutoff valve is a common repair we perform. Our plumbers are skilled in working within tight spaces, such as under sinks or behind toilets, to minimize disruption to your home. We'll first safely shut off the water at the main if necessary, then efficiently replace the faulty valve with a new, reliable one. This restores proper water control to your fixture and is a crucial repair for preventing minor leaks from turning into larger plumbing emergencies.
